common intertidal amphipod

<em>Gammarus locusta</em>, commonly known as the common intertidal amphipod, is a crustacean in the family Gammaridae. Its conservation status has not been formally evaluated by the IUCN. The species is recorded from Denmark, Norway, Portugal, and Sweden, indicating a distribution along the northeastern Atlantic coast of Europe. It typically inhabits intertidal and shallow subtidal marine and estuarine environments, where it is found among algae, under rocks, and in sediments. Gammarus amphipods are ecologically important as detritivores and as prey for shorebirds, fish, and other invertebrates in coastal food webs.
